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| corn leaf aphid | Fat-tailed Jird |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(Animals) | Animalia (Animals) |
| Phylum | Arthropoda (Arthropods) | Chordata (Chordates) |
| Class | Insecta (Insects) | Mammalia (Mammals) |
| Order | Hemiptera (Hemiptera) | Rodentia (Rodents) |
| Family | Aphididae | Muridae (Mice & Rats) |
| Genus | Rhopalosiphum | Pachyuromys |
| Species | Rhopalosiphum maidis | Pachyuromys duprasi |
